First of all, it looks nothing like any creme brulee that I've ever eaten. Discovered in the Long Island garden of Lois Woodhull, Coreopsis 'Creme Brulee' is a unique, interspecific hybrid between C. grandiflora and possibly C. 'Moonbeam'. The 3' wide, tight clumps have dark green foliage that resemble a lacy leaf C. grandiflora. Starting in midsummer and continuing through fall, the floriferous clumps are topped with deep butter-yellow flowers.
